Nigeria army offers free treatment to 1,000 persons

Over 1,000 residents of Rumeme community in Obio Akpor Local Government Area  of Rivers State have  benefited from the medical outreach carried out by the 6 Division of the Nigerian Army, Port Harcourt.

The medical outreach was part of events marking Army Day celeberation in Port Harcourt.

Speaking at  the event,  the General  Officer commanding 6 Division of the Nigerian Army , Major  General Enobong  Udoh  said more than 1,000 residents were treated of various ailments  while HIV screening and health education was carried out to enlighten the participants on what to do to maintain healthy living.

Major General Udoh who was represented by Commander of Military Hospital, Port Harcourt, Audu Jimmie Enogela called on residents of Port Harcourt to take care of their health by going for medical check up always.

One of the beneficiaries of the medical outreach, Peter  Chindah commended the army for providing free  medical services to the people of the area.
